    David M.

    Barsotti's in the oak lawn neighborhood of Dallas has some really good Italian food. We went on a Saturday night and managed to sit at the bar. I would advise getting a reservation if you are wanting a table. The service was great and all the staff members were super friendly and had stories to tell and would easily make conversation. The food was even better. We started off with the chilled crab claws. The claws were already pulled and you didn't have to do a lot to get the meat out of them. Our two entrees we got was the Ravioli and tortellini vodka. Both came out in a delicious sauce and had plenty of flavor to the dish. Reasonable priced as well. For dessert we had to try the cannoli. You get one vanilla and then one chocolate. The vibe of the restaurant has an old 1920s vibe to the establishment. When I'm in Dallas next this would be a place I would go back to.

    Debra M.

    What a find! This is the best Italian food I've had outside of Italy. I wish I could get this level of food and service locally because it's phenomenal. Formerly Carbones, the southern Italian flavors are welcome and prominent. MB and I lunched here on a Sunday afternoon before heading to the airport. I was immediately drawn to the cozy interior and beautiful bar, but we sat at a table by the windows for people watching. I had the Shrimp Scampi Linguine after joking with our server that scampi is shrimp in Italian. The Shrimp Shrimp Linguine. (I'm here all week, folks!) The house-made linguine came with fat, perfectly cooked shrimp and an out-of-this-world sauce. I was able to eat all the shrimp and maybe 1/3 of the massive serving of linguine. Probably not that massive but we old people have smaller appetites! MB ordered the Creste Sunday Gravy, a delightfully spicy sauce with sausage served over tender creste paste, a unique extruded pasta that looks like little rollercoasters and holds the sauce in its texture.
